    door lock replacement question

    So i bought an 89 e30 and it only unlocks from the trunk. turning the key from the trunk locks/unlocks the entire car so the central locking system is fine. Should i be looking to replace the door lock cylinders, and if so, is there a way to replace both driver and passenger locks while still keeping my same existing key? part numbers or links would be much appreciated!!     I'm kinda going through a similar rectification on my car. Same symptoms until not even the trunk would work. What I've found so far is a broken driver door cylinder.
    Both fcp euro and ecs have replacement cylinders for both sides. Any cylinder can be matched to any key is how I understand it. You arrange the shims? In the same sequence as your existing cylinder. There are some straight forward video tutorials out there.

        Does the passenger side luck/unlock the doors? There is a 'micro-switch' in the drivers door that, when activated, locks and unlocks the doors.
